Drain Cleaning in Incline Village — Local Notes
- •Luxury Lake Tahoe waterfront homes often feature long private laterals that run under steep driveways and require specialized equipment for root removal.
- •Alpine winters with heavy snow can limit access on NV-431, so we schedule around weather windows and carry extra tools for frozen lines.
- •Washoe County rules near the lake emphasize containment during drain work to avoid runoff into Tahoe, which our crews follow on every job.
- •Many properties in Crystal Bay use septic systems tied to main drains, so clearing work must account for tank locations and local permit steps.
